Bootstrap 是一个流行的前端框架,它提供了丰富的组件和工具,可以帮助开发者快速构建响应式和美观的网站。本文将介绍如何使用 Bootstrap 搭配技巧,打造个性化网站,并为你提供入门实践指南。

一、了解Bootstrap

Bootstrap 是一个开源的前端框架,它包含了栅格系统、预定义的样式和组件,可以帮助开发者快速搭建网页。它支持多种浏览器,并且易于扩展。

1.1 栅格系统

Bootstrap 的栅格系统允许网页内容在不同屏幕尺寸下自动布局和响应。通过使用栅格类(如 .row.col-xs-*),可以将内容分为12个等宽的列。

1.2 预定义样式和组件

Bootstrap 提供了丰富的预定义样式和组件,如按钮、表单、导航栏、模态框等,这些可以帮助开发者快速构建页面布局。

二、个性化Bootstrap网站

要打造个性化网站,你需要了解如何使用 Bootstrap 的自定义选项,包括修改变量、创建自定义主题和添加自定义样式。

2.1 修改Bootstrap变量

Bootstrap 提供了一个变量文件 bootstrap/_variables.scss,你可以在其中修改颜色、字体大小等变量。例如:

$brand-primary: teal !default;
$font-size-base: 14px !default;

2.2 创建自定义主题

通过修改变量文件,你可以创建一个自定义主题。然后,在项目的入口文件中引入这个主题文件:

<link rel="stylesheet" href="path/to/your/custom-theme.css">

2.3 添加自定义样式

除了修改 Bootstrap 变量外,你还可以添加自定义样式来覆盖默认样式。这可以通过在项目的 CSS 文件中添加 .custom 类来实现:

.custom {
  .btn {
    background-color: #333;
    color: #fff;
  }
}

三、实践指南

以下是一些使用 Bootstrap 搭建个性化网站的实践指南:

3.1 确定网站风格

在开始之前,确定你的网站风格和目标用户。这将帮助你选择合适的颜色、字体和布局。

3.2 创建基本布局

使用 Bootstrap 的栅格系统创建基本布局。将内容分为12个等宽的列,并根据需要调整列的宽度。

3.3 添加组件

使用 Bootstrap 的组件,如按钮、表单、导航栏等,来丰富你的网站内容。

3.4 自定义样式

根据需要,添加自定义样式来覆盖默认样式,打造个性化网站。

3.5 测试和优化

在完成网站开发后,测试网站在不同设备和浏览器上的兼容性,并进行必要的优化。

四、总结

通过了解 Bootstrap 的基本概念、个性化配置和实践指南,你可以轻松入门并打造个性化的网站。掌握这些技巧,将有助于你在前端开发领域取得更大的成就。